    The Fifth Floor - Who is Yevgeny Prigozhin? - BBC Sounds

    Yevgeny Prigozhin is the head of the Russian mercenary group Wagner, a role that he denied until September. Andrei Zakharov of BBC Russian has been investigating the story of Mr Prigozhin for many years, and he shares his insights.
